Families can meet a variety of dinosaurs at a Liverpool venue over the Easter holidays.
Teach Rex is bringing its interactive dinosaur show to Camp and Furnace to teach kids all about the anatomy and life of dinosaurs.
The new 45 minute show will teach families about the Velociraptor and incorporates music and effects. Afterwards, the audience can get up close and personal with a variety of dinosaurs.

Children will be greeted by baby dinosaurs and will receive a “Dino Booklet” which includes educational activities and coloured crayons.

The educational experience, which is delivered by primary school teachers, will take the audience on an interactive prehistoric journey, explaining misconceptions surrounding the Velociraptor.
Families will meet various Velociraptors, including the only fully feathered Velociraptor in the world.
The show will run for approximately 45 minutes and families can meet and greet the dinosaurs afterwards. There will be photo opportunities with the creatures and a chance to enjoy a dance with them.
Teach Rex is suitable for all ages (over three recommended) and takes place at Camp and Furnace on Thursday, April 14.
Children's tickets cost £11, adults £15.40, and family tickets (two adults and two children) cost £44. You can book tickets here.
Camp and Furnace is at 67 Greenland St, Liverpool L1, 0BY
